Taking Care of Your Mind: Key Wellness Strategies

In today's fast-paced world, it's more important than ever to prioritize your well-being. Your mental health shapes every aspect of your life, from your relationships to your productivity. Here are some essential tips to help you build a strong and healthy mind:

* Implement regular self-care activities that provide you joy and relaxation. This could include devoting time in nature, listening to music, reading, or enjoying hobbies.

* Create healthy boundaries with others to protect your emotional energy. Understand how to say no to demands that drain you and emphasize relationships that are fulfilling.

* Cultivate a positive mindset by embracing gratitude, concentrating on the good in your life, and addressing negative thoughts.

Connect with others regularly to build strong social connections. Relationships provide encouragement during difficult times and can enhance overall well-being.

Exploring the Maze: Understanding Mental Health Awareness Month

May marks a crucial month get more info for raising attention about mental health. This annual observance, known as Mental Health Awareness Month, extends a platform to highlight the importance of recognizing mental well-being. It's a time to eliminate the barriers surrounding mental health issues and promote open talks.

  • Across this month, numerous campaigns are launched to inform the public about mental health issues. Events ranging from seminars to support groups provide valuable tools for individuals seeking assistance.
  • With actively participating in these efforts, we can make a difference in creating a more understanding culture where mental health is respected.
